UAI Urquiza's Clear Edge in the Head-to-Head Record
When examining the historical matchups between these two sides, UAI Urquiza holds a commanding position. Across the last 16 meetings, UAI Urquiza has secured nine victories compared to just four for Flandria, with three matches ending in stalemate. That win ratio of over 56% for the visitors illustrates a consistent pattern of success against this particular opponent, suggesting UAI Urquiza approaches this fixture with significant psychological confidence built from years of competitive history.
Recent form within this fixture tells a more nuanced story, however. In the last five encounters, the results have alternated between both sides without either establishing a sustained winning streak. UAI Urquiza claimed the most recent meeting in March 2026 with a 2-0 scoreline, but Flandria responded with a 1-0 victory in July 2025 and had also won 2-0 in February of that same year. UAI Urquiza's previous triumph came in July 2024 by a 2-1 margin, while a 0-0 draw in February 2024 rounds out the recent sequence. This pattern suggests neither team enters with a psychological stranglehold, despite the overall historical advantage favouring UAI Urquiza.
The goal data reinforces a picture of tight, low-scoring affairs. The average of 1.88 goals across the 16 meetings points toward competitive but conservative encounters. Perhaps most telling for match prediction purposes is the BTTS rate of just 31%, meaning both teams have found the net in fewer than one in three of their meetings. The historical evidence suggests goals may be at a premium in this fixture, with clean sheets and narrow margins forming the established pattern between these rivals.
